Local Printing

Shopping locally has numerous advantages over using a printer that is not located in your area, the most important of which is the fact that you’ll get to know the person you’re dealing with. You’ll build a relationship that will help you with your projects in the future and it can also help strengthen the local economy as your money will be spent in the area rather than shipped to a remote location where the print shop isn’t located.
Moreover, by dealing with a local shop you won’t be forced to pay for shipping costs to ship samples, proofs or finished products to you.

A custom logo design should be visually appealing, memorable, and representative of the brand’s identity and values. Here are some key aspects of custom logo design:

  1. Understanding the Brand: The first step in custom logo design is to understand the brand’s identity, values, and target audience. This involves researching the company’s history, mission, and goals, as well as analyzing its competitors and market position.
  2. Design Process: Once the brand’s identity has been established, the designer can begin the design process. This involves creating sketches and drafts, refining and iterating on ideas, and incorporating feedback from the client.
  3. Elements of a Logo: A custom logo typically includes several elements, including typography, color scheme, imagery, and composition. These elements should work together to create a cohesive and effective visual representation of the brand.
  4. Importance of Color: Color plays a crucial role in logo design. Different colors have different connotations and can evoke different emotions in viewers. For example, blue is often associated with trust and professionalism, while red is associated with passion and energy.
  5. Scalability: A good custom logo design should be scalable, meaning it can be resized and reproduced in different formats without losing quality or clarity. This is important for ensuring the logo looks good on everything from business cards to billboards.
  6. Copyright and Trademark: Once the custom logo design is finalized, it’s important to protect it with copyright and trademark registrations. This can prevent others from using a similar logo and help establish the brand’s identity in the marketplace.

Overall, custom logo design is an important aspect of branding and marketing for any company or product. A well-designed logo can help establish brand recognition, build trust with customers, and create a strong visual identity for the brand.
